Output 768820c106f31c18747844c0c190aac4cb652644c9e4fb84d77ab36f7684ee6e:0

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343de424cc3f428eea2619dcaf8ac7bddf06bc1b OP_EQUAL
address
36TFCo199UJ7X2wGsSRsdA7JoLqL1FTZXN
transaction
768820c106f31c18747844c0c190aac4cb652644c9e4fb84d77ab36f7684ee6e
spent
true